If you are the Advisory Committee Representative of the W3C Member
You are the person responsible for formally joining this group on behalf of your organization and then nominating
individuals to the group. You may also receive requests from others in your organization suggesting that you
join the group; there is a tool to manage the
queue of requests to join groups.
If you are not the Advisory Committee Representative for your organization
Use the Join form
to notify your Advisory Committee Representative that you wish to join the group.
Your Advisory Committee Representative will determine whether to join the group and have the
opportunity to nominate you to represent your organization in the group.
You will be notified once you have been nominated, at which point you may begin your participation
in the group.
If this is not an option and you think that you have the expertise and availability to
participate, you may request to participate as an Invited Expert as follows. Note: Your application is subject to approval by the Chairs and Staff Contacts of this group.
Please contact
Shawn Lawton Henry, Kevin White to discuss your intent to complete an application before starting the process.
Complete a W3C
Invited Expert Application. You should receive a reply within ten (10) business
days. If your request is accepted, you will receive an invitation with
additional instructions for formally joining the group.
